About the Role

We're hiring on behalf of our client — a growing outside plant (OSP) fiber infrastructure company delivering large-scale fiber optic construction projects across multiple U.S. markets.

The Senior Project Manager will be responsible for managing the end-to-end delivery of large-scale fiber optic construction projects across multiple markets. This role will oversee project timelines, budgets, permitting, vendor coordination, and customer communications to ensure successful fiber deployments that meet operational and financial targets. The ideal candidate brings deep experience in OSP fiber construction, strong organizational and communication skills, and the ability to manage complex projects independently in a fast-paced, multi-stakeholder environment.

Responsibilities

  • Identify candidate OSP engineering/construction firms; manage the bid/vendor selection process and contract negotiation

  • Own tactical project management, including project schedules, running regular project calls, and supporting project functions (securing bonds, internal signatures for permits, etc.)

  • Provide build cost estimates for the sales team

  • Perform service delivery functions, including regular customer updates (written and/or oral), coordinating site access, and close-out package preparation

  • Conduct site walks with customers and vendors

  • Work with local/state/federal permitting agencies to secure timely permit approvals

  • Provide direction and coordination of project environmental requirements, tasks, and activities

  • Manage environmental engineering vendors and related subcontractors as they secure related permitting

  • Document splicing requirements and maintain fiber engineering documentation

  • Specify and procure optics components for contractor installation

  • Maintain up-to-date network maps in the company's proprietary geospatial project management platform, including in-flight design changes and final as-built routes

  • Provide accurate network maps to state 811 agencies and the company's NOC

  • Manage network maintenance and relocation projects (including emergency maintenance)
